Output 7d01dbf02e61c1681a9405c3eed168608a1da2bfc51c75bcdff1e03575911526:1

value
814901758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64a0016b0fc1369a1d7655027ec963935a33397 OP_EQUAL
address
3ME5BEGpyEXQK6RtZWT5vJvkx8sb1itBTY
transaction
7d01dbf02e61c1681a9405c3eed168608a1da2bfc51c75bcdff1e03575911526
confirmations
451635
spent
true